Stiff + Trevillion Creates an Attention-Grabbing Structure

This iridescent turquoise facade is located in London's Soho neighborhood. The strikingly elegant structure is completed by local studio Stiff + Trevillion. The architects wanted to create an engaging design that would infuse the site with a strong and vibrant character. This is undoubtedly achieved through the implementation of the beautiful turquoise facade. In total, the building spans across 2,570 square meters, spread out on five storeys and a basement.
Stiff + Trevillion's elegant design captured the attention of artist Damian Hirst who acquired the building for £40 million. The structure will now house an art complex, the artist's main studio, as well as another location of 'Sticks n Sushi.'
